How they compare
Belize currently reports 76.7 TJ against 74.64 TJ in Costa Rica, a difference of 2.06 TJ.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Costa Rica ahead.
Belize ranks 100th and Costa Rica ranks 102nd of 147 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Belize averaged higher in 2 and Costa Rica in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belize | Costa Rica |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 15.93 TJ | 240.31 TJ | 224.38 TJ | Costa Rica |
| 2000s | 65.42 TJ | 157.19 TJ | 91.77 TJ | Costa Rica |
| 2010s | 90.2 TJ | 36.15 TJ | 54.05 TJ | Belize |
| 2020s | 90.59 TJ | 54.88 TJ | 35.71 TJ | Belize |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ain Bioenergy contains data on bioenergy use and bioenergy production, covering the following items: i) animal waste, ii) bagasse, iii) bio jet kerosene, iv) biodiesel, v) biogases, vi) biogasoline, vii) black liquor, viii) charcoal, ix) fuelwood, x) other liquid biofuels, xi) other vegetal material and residues.
